Caring for Our Senior Friars
I guess I would have to regard stumbling upon this newly uploaded video as providential. It contains interviews with several senior Capuchin friars including our longtime former Spiritual Assistant, Fr. Andy Drew, OFM Cap.. Fr. Andy guided us from initial inception (meaning before we were established as a fraternity) through the mid to late 1990's. At that time he was serving as Catholic Chaplain to Norwich State Hospital. Our founder Lillian France, who had moved from Ohio to the Norwich area, was inspired to form a new fraternity and sought his assistance...and the rest is history. It's really good to see him and hear his voice.

The Destiny of Humanity: On the Meaning of Marriage | Part 1 of 6 of The...
Humanum Colloquium: The Vatican hosted a three-day ecumenical conference on male-female complementarity. A six-part series of videos shown during the Humanum colloquim-hailed as a conference highlight - spans continents as it tells the story of men, women and family. The videos are available to watch free online at www.humanum.it/en The first video is below.
Please note that there are actually two distinct sets of videos available. One set contains the colloquium speakers and their presentations (one of whom is Pope Francis). The other series is called The Humanum Series.
(Source: OSV- Our Sunday Visitor Newsweekly - 12/07/2014)
